Denmark Donator of Fund for Public Administration Reform in B&H

Published: March 25, 2014
Share
SHARE

reforma_javne_upraveMinistry of Foreign Affairs of the Kingdom of Denmark is the new donor of the fund for the public administration in B&H, after the Annex IV of the Memorandum of Understanding for the establishment of the fund was signed by the Chairman of the B&H Council of Ministers, Prime Ministers of entities, the Mayor of Brčko District, the representative of the Ministry of Finance and Treasury of B&H and the representatives of the donor fund, announced the Office of Coordinator for Public Administration Reform.

The signing of the new annex of this Memorandum enables the Ministry of Foreign Affairs of Denmark to invest in a fund an amount of 28.25 million Danish crones in the next three years, which is approximately 3.76 million Euros.

During this year, in the fund 12.5 million Danish crones, or 1.7 million Euros will be invested. The Ministry of Foreign Affairs of Denmark decided to invest the money to this fund after the Board of Directors of the Fund for Public Administration Reform adopted the list of 23 projects.

These are projects from all six reform sectors defined by the Strategy for Public Administration of B&H: strategic planning, coordination and policy making, public finance, administrative procedures and administrative services, human resources management, E- administration and institutional communication.

(Source: Fena)
